Well I read all the info on making the rear 12 volt socket permanantly live and did the job to-day. Cut the feed to the three 15amp fuses on the top row and branched a feed in from the other top row fuses. BINGO!! socket live and blinds also with ing key out. Problem, beeper beeping and sidelights on. Think again, took the new feed out and ran one from battery. Same problem. Put it all back to square one and had a think. I have now taken a feed from the rear interior light to a new socket and all is well. I also today did the fuel sender earth wire and the guage is now A1.
